The election of Members-at-Large (term 1 January 2013 through 31 December 2015) and the Directors-at-Large for Regions 1-6 and Region 8 (term 1 January 2013 through 31 December 2014) of the IEEE SPS Board of Governors is now open. Ballots must be received at IEEE no later than 30 August 2012 in order to be counted.

The IEEE Board of Directors has nominated IEEE Fellows J. Roberto Boisson de Marca and Tariq S. Durrani as candidates for 2013 IEEE President-Elect. The two men, chosen by the board in November, are set to face off in the annual election this year. The winner of the election will serve as 2014 IEEE President.

The SPS Awards Board is now accepting nominations for 2012 major SPS awards, including the Society Award, the Technical Achievement Award, the Education Award, the Meritorious Service Award, the Best Paper Award, Young Author Best Paper Award, Signal Processing Magazine Best Paper Award and Best Column Award.. Prospective nominators are encouraged to submit nominations well in advance of the deadline of 1 October 2012.

At its 31 March 2012 meeting, the Board of Governors of the IEEE Signal Processing Society passed amendments to the Society’s Constitution document. Procedures require approval by the IEEE Technical Activities Board, which has already been secured, followed by a 30-day period for member comment. The amendment is considered approved unless one-half percent or more of the Society’s membership objects, in writing, within 30 days of publication. Publication here fulfills the latter portion of the approval requirement.

The Nominate a Senior Member Initiative was designed to encourage all IEEE Societies and Sections to become actively involved in promoting the Senior Member grade.

This initiative aims to:

* encourage grade advancement in IEEE;
* simplify the application process;
* offer financial incentives for approved Senior Member applications;
* offer increased benefits for Senior membership.

The IEEE Signal Processing Society (SPS) invites nominations for the position of Director-Membership Services. The term for the Director position will be three years (1 January 2013-31 December 2015).
